Brief

Brighton and Hove City Council is seeking a Community Engagement Partner to support the Whitehawk Pride in Place programme, a major community-led investment initiative. The successful organisation(s) will help local residents shape the future of their neighbourhood by facilitating inclusive engagement across diverse groups including residents, young people, families, local businesses, schools, faith groups, and voluntary organisations. Key responsibilities include: awareness raising, community conversations, pop-up engagement activities, drop-in sessions, survey support, targeted outreach, community champion coordination, and gathering resident feedback to inform investment decisions and long-term neighbourhood planning. Applicants should have strong local knowledge of Brighton and Whitehawk, proven experience in inclusive community engagement, and a commitment to working respectfully with underheard voices. This is a time-sensitive opportunity with a final report deadline of November 2026. Expressions of interest are particularly encouraged from organisations with experience in community development, neighbourhood planning, resident research, youth engagement, or partnership-led outreach.
